Elevated Plains, VIC had 39 residents at the 2021 Census, with the broader statistical area showing a 6.3% growth over the last five years. The predominant age group is 55-64 years, and the median age sits at 55. Households are most often couples with children, and those with a mortgage repay a median of $4,333 a month. Around 100.0% of homes are owner-occupied, with the largest single tenure being owned outright at 69.2%. Most dwellings are separate houses, making up 100.0% of the suburb's housing stock. Public transport coverage spans 3 GTFS stops across the suburb. Source: ABS Census 2021 and Estimated Resident Population, with amenity counts from state Open Data and OpenStreetMap.

Planning zones
8 zones in suburb| Code | Zone | % covered | Area |
|---|---|---|---|
| FZ2 | Farming Zone Schedule 2Rural | 52.1% | 1.96 km² |
| PCRZ | Public Conservation and Resource ZoneEnvironmental | 26.3% | 0.99 km² |
| RLZ1 | Rural Living Zone Schedule 1Rural | 17.6% | 0.66 km² |
| NRZ4 | Neighbourhood Residential Zone Schedule 4Residential | 1.5% | 0.06 km² |
| PPRZ | Public Park and Recreation ZoneRecreation | 1.2% | 0.04 km² |
| RCZ2 | Rural Conservation Zone Schedule 2Rural | 0.7% | 0.03 km² |
| PUZ1 | Public Use Zone Schedule 1Special use | 0.4% | 0.01 km² |
| TRZ3 | TRZ3Other | 0.2% | 8,190 m² |
Source: VIC DTP Vicmap Planning Zones (ZONE_VIC/2026-04-29/08783d2926383881) · As of Apr 2026. Zone boundaries are amended periodically; verify the exact property with the relevant council before relying on permitted use.
